Knowledge Institute of Technology (KIOT) is a premiere educational institution located in Salem, Tamil Nadu. It was established in 2009 and is affiliated to Anna University, Chennai.
KIOT offers undergraduate, postgraduate and Ph.D. level degree courses in various disciplines of engineering. The courses offered by Knowledge Institute of Technology are approved by the All India Council for Technical Education (AICTE). The institute itself is accredited by the National Assessment & Accreditation Council (NAAC) with “B++” Grade.

Knowledge Institute of Technology B.E/B.Tech Admission 2023
Knowledge Institute of Technology offers undergraduate level engineering degree (B.E./B.Tech) courses in various disciplines. The basic eligibility criteria for admission is a pass in HSC/ 10+2 with 50% marks in Physics, Mathematics and Chemistry taken together. Candidates are selected on the basis of marks obtained in the last qualifying exam through Anna University’s TNEA counseling. Candidates seeking admission under management quota can apply for direct admission by contacting the institute.

Knowledge Institute of Technology M.E. Admission 2023
The Institute offers postgraduate level degree programs in four engineering specializations, viz. Industrial Safety Engineering, VLSI Design, Computer Science, and Embedded System Technologies. The basic eligibility criteria for admission to M.E. programs is a B.E./ B. Tech degree in the relevant or allied discipline with 50% marks.
Candidates are selected on the basis of their GATE/ TANCET score through TANCA counselling. GATE candidates are not required to take the TANCET exam, but must register for TANCA regardless.

Key Points for M.E. Admission:
- GATE candidates who have qualified the entrance exam in 2021, 2022 and 2023 only are eligible to apply for TANCA Counselling.
- GATE score from previous years are not acceptable.
- Candidates with B.E./ B. Tech degrees obtained through Distance Mode/ Weekend courses are not eligible for TANCA counselling.
- Candidates belonging to a state other than Tamil Nadu are exempt from reservation and must apply under the open category only.

Knowledge Institute of Technology Application Process 2023
Knowledge Institute of Technology fills its govt. quota seats through state-level counselling conducted by Anna University. Undergraduate level engineering candidates are admitted through TNEA counselling; postgraduate seats are filled through TANCA. The institute also accepts applications for management quota seats. Candidates seeking admission under management quota can contact the institute directly for information regarding the admission procedure.
The application and counselling process for govt. quota seats for admission to B.E./B.Tech and M.E. programs is as follows:
- Candidates may apply for TNEA/ TANCA counselling by visiting the Anna University website.
- The online application/ registration form must be duly filled with all requisite details.
- The prescribed application fee for TNEA/ TANCA can be paid online through various payment modes such as credit/ debit card, internet banking etc.
- Candidates can also choose to pay the application fee through demand draft drawn in favor of Anna University, Chennai.
- After submission of application form and payment of the prescribed application fee, candidate must take a printout of the complete application form for future correspondence.
- Candidate must send a copy of the complete application form along with all necessary enclosures to the Director of Admissions, Anna University or to the Principal of the College.
- Anna University publishes a merit list shortly after closing the application process based on the applicants’ merit/ entrance exam score.
- Candidates whose names are on the merit list must download the counselling call letter.
- He/ she is then required to appear for counselling on the prescribed dates for seat allotment.
- A DD for the prescribed counselling fee (INR 5000 for the current academic session) must be carried by the candidate along with the original copy of the counselling call letter.
- Candidates eligible for counselling must report at any of the bank counters at the Anna University premises and produce his/ her DD for obtaining the counselling form.
- Candidate with the highest rank gets the first opportunity to exercise his options, and the pattern follows.
- In the next step,candidate must sign the admission order and hand over the DD to the counsellor.
- He/ she must then report at the institute allotted (KIOT, in this case) with the allotment letter in order to complete the admission process.

Knowledge Institute of Technology Reservation
The institute provides reservation of seats to eligible candidates from reserved categories based on norms set by Anna University and the Tamil Nadu state government. The following reservations are currently being offered by the institute:
Category | Reservation of Seats |
---|---|
Open Competition (OC) | 31% |
Backward Class (BC) | 26.5% |
Backward Class – Muslim (BCM) | 3.5% |
Most Backward Class & De-notified Communities (MBC & DNC) | 20% |
Scheduled Caste (SC) | 15% |
Scheduled Caste - Arunthathiyars (SCA) | 3% |
Scheduled Tribe (ST) | 1% |
